The structure of the SLG7 sliding guide shoe

The SLG7 sliding guide shoe is usually composed of the following main parts:


The main body of the guide shoe: The main part of the guide shoe is usually made of high-strength metal materials (such as cast iron or aluminum alloy), which has good wear resistance and impact resistance.


Sliding gasket: The sliding gasket is the part of the guide shoe that comes into direct contact with the guide rail. It is usually made of high molecular materials (such as polyurethane or nylon), featuring a low coefficient of friction and excellent self-lubricating performance.


Fixing device: It is used to fix the guide shoe to the elevator car or counterweight device, and usually includes bolts, washers and fasteners, etc.


Adjustment mechanism: Some SLG7 guide shoes are equipped with an adjustment mechanism to adjust the gap between the guide shoes and the guide rails, ensuring smooth operation.



The working principle of the SLG7 sliding guide shoe

The working principle of the SLG7 sliding guide shoe is based on the principle of sliding friction. During the operation of the elevator, the sliding pads of the guide shoes come into contact with the surface of the guide rails, guiding the car or counterweight device to move up and down along the guide rails through sliding friction. The low friction coefficient and self-lubricating property of the sliding liner effectively reduce the running resistance and noise, while improving the operational efficiency of the elevator.


The gap between the guide shoe and the guide rail needs to be precisely adjusted through the regulating mechanism. Excessive clearance can cause the cabin to shake, affecting the comfort of the ride. If the gap is too small, it will increase the frictional resistance, leading to accelerated wear of the guide shoes and guide rails. Therefore, the design and installation of the SLG7 sliding guide shoe must strictly follow relevant technical standards.



Technical features of the SLG7 sliding guide shoe

High wear resistance: The sliding gasket is made of high-performance materials, which can maintain a low wear rate during long-term operation and extend its service life.


Low-noise design: By optimizing materials and structural design, the noise generated by the SLG7 guide shoe during operation is significantly reduced, enhancing the comfort of the elevator ride.


Easy to install and maintain: The structure design of the guide shoe is simple, making installation and adjustment convenient, and also facilitating daily inspection and maintenance.


Good adaptability: The SLG7 guide shoe is suitable for various types of elevator guide rails and can maintain stable performance in different operating environments.


Environmental protection and energy conservation: The low-friction design reduces the energy consumption of elevator operation, meeting the energy conservation and environmental protection requirements of modern elevators.

Maintenance and care of the SLG7 sliding guide shoe

To ensure the long-term stable operation of the SLG7 sliding guide shoe, regular maintenance and upkeep are indispensable. The following are some common maintenance measures:


Regular inspection: Regularly inspect the wear condition of the guide boots, especially the thickness and surface condition of the sliding pads. If severe wear is found, it should be replaced in time.


Clean the guide rails: Keep the surface of the guide rails clean to prevent dust, oil stains and other impurities from entering between the guide shoes and the guide rails, which may affect the operational performance.


Adjust the gap: Regularly check the gap between the guide shoe and the guide rail. If necessary, adjust it through the regulating mechanism to ensure that the gap meets the standard.


Lubrication and maintenance: Although the SLG7 guide shoe has self-lubricating properties, in some special cases, a proper amount of lubricant can be added to reduce friction.


Record operational data: Establish operational records of the guide boots, including replacement times, wear conditions, etc., to promptly identify problems and take corresponding measures.
